Brown meat. … Web2 days ago · Donna Britt. El Rodeo’s Pork Osso Bucco with green sauce is fall-off-the-bone tender and full of flavor. Traditional Italian osso bucco is made with veal or other beef shanks, braised in a tomato and wine sauce. El Rodeo's version is a pork shank braised in a green or verde sauce. tristone movie theatre palm desert
